whenever I change the Driver "nv" section in XFree86Config to Driver "nvidia"(after emerging nvidia-glx and nvidia-kernel, k wont start. it says that it cant load the nvidia driver. Ive tried typing opengl-update nvidia, but it still wont work, and to get into x again i have to type opengl-update with no arguments. Has anyone had this problem? |

Is the kernel module loading? i.e. if you do an 'lsmod' are you seeing NVdriver in the list of loaded moduled? If not, try manually loading it with a "modprobe NVdriver". |
